grozzle,

He only ever paid the interest, nothing on the principal, and the loan was forgiven/written-off before even the interest payments matched the principal.

This loan write-off is legally counted as “income” and if he didn’t pay tax on it he’s a criminal, and if the IRS don’t investigate, they’re not doing their fucking job.
